Balanced Offense Powers Scranton Men’s Basketball to Ninth Straight Win at Susquehanna, 75-65

Box Score SELINSGROVE, PA - The University of Scranton men's basketball team put together a balanced offensive performance on Saturday afternoon, earning a 75-65 win over Susquehanna University to improve to 12-1 overall and 5-1 in Landmark play this season.

The Basics

  • Final Score: Scranton 75, Susquehanna 65
  • Record: Scranton (12-1, 5-1 Landmark)

How It Happened

  • Susquehanna jumped out to a 9-2 lead in the opening three minutes, with Hamilton Roth accounting for Scranton's lone bucket early.
  • The Royals quickly found their rhythm, responding with a surge over the next four-and-a-half minutes to grab their first lead at 14-13, sparked by a trio of three-pointers from Ben Robinson, Josias Carbon and Luca Baratta.
  • The game remained tight as the half continued, with the lead changing hands several times. Jon Spatola drilled a three-pointer at the 3:12 mark and followed with a pair of free throws to push the Royals in front 32-27. The River Hawks added two more points before the end of the period as Scranton took a 34-29 lead into the break.
  • The Royals began the second half strong, opening the second half with a 7-4 run over the first five minutes. Brendan Carr sparked the push, hitting a three-pointer just 1:30 into the period, while Sammy Tornabene and Nick Ruisi added two points apiece to help Scranton build a 41-33 advantage.
  • Susquehanna pushed back, cutting the deficit to just two points at 43-41 with 13:31 remaining. During the stretch, the River Hawks scored six points at the line, while Scranton's only basket came on a layup from Josias Carbon, allowing Susquehanna to outscore the Royals 8-2 and close the gap. The two teams continued to exchange blows over the next few minutes, but Scranton retained the lead thought the half.
  • With Scranton leading the River Hawks 53-51, the Royals ran away with the game over the final seven minutes, going on a 22-14 run to close out the game. Carr led the way with eight points and Roth scored six points during the final stretch of the game, closing out a 75-65 win for the Royals.

Inside the Box Score

  • FG%: Scranton 47.9%, Susquehanna 30.6%
  • 3PT: Scranton 9-20, Susquehanna 1-20
  • FT: Scranton 20-26, Susquehanna 26-37
  • Rebounds: Scranton 27, Susquehanna 50
